Episode Synopsis "Episode 3 - Angela Breckenridge, PhD, on Maintaining Mental Health while Staying Safe at Home"
Dr. Angela Breckenridge, Director of Curriculum and Program Assessment at the Tulane University School of Public Health and Tropical Medicine, provide listeners with coping strategies for maintaining mental health during this period of global isolation. With a focus on the impact of isolation and "social" (physical) distancing, Dr. Breckenridge looks at how we can mitigate that cost with strategies for our own mental wellness and that of those who may be struggling alone.
